    Y'all know I love a book store and a used book store is even better. The prices are good and I sort of love the homemade feel of the shelving and the labyrinthian path you follow to continue from one letter to the next. The layout is good (although there are a LOT of steps if that's an issue for you). Selections were interesting. My favorite area was the basement mystery section. It was very atmospheric... Lights go out and you're now in the murder mystery! Will definitely stop back in on my next trip to town.

    LOVE. Really enjoy browsing this used bookshop in Wicker Park There are so many fantastic options...they actually boast having over 70k books in stock! That's insane. They also buy books on Fridays & Saturdays during select hours. So those of you doing some Marie Kondo-ing like myself can make a few dollars off their already read books they're clearing out. Plus, live music on Mondays! Saturday night live readings! Happy to have Myopic in the 'hood!
